What is the average outside diameter of a cylinder with a taped circumference of 9,425mm?

To determine the average outside diameter of a cylinder from its circumference, you can use the relationship between circumference (C) and diameter (D), given by the formula:

[ C = \pi \times D ]

In this case, we have the circumference of the cylinder as 9,425 mm. To find the diameter, rearrange the formula to solve for D:

[ D = \frac{C}{\pi} ]

Substituting the circumference into the equation gives:

[ D = \frac{9,425 \text{ mm}}{\pi} ]

Using the value of π (approximately 3.14159):

[ D \approx \frac{9,425 \text{ mm}}{3.14159} \approx 2995.4 \text{ mm} ]

Rounding this value to the nearest hundred gives an approximate outside diameter of 3,000 mm. Therefore, this corresponds to the choice that indicates 3,000 mm as the average outside diameter.

Understanding this calculation is crucial for accurately determining dimensions in welding and fabrication, where measurements must be precise to ensure proper fit and quality in constructions.
